On the loess plateau, water is the main limiting factors for vegetation growth. root distribution characters have special ecological meaning as it reflected the utilizations of trees to the environments. even - aged stands of robinia pseudoacacia on slope lands facing south and north were selected as sampling plots for root distribution investigation. investigatiing results showed that indicated that on all sites, root biomass decreased with depth, and the distribution depth of fine root was deeper than that of coarser root. the results of variance analysis indicated that there were great differences in root biomass among different diameter classes, and coarser root was the main sources of variance, and the root biomass, especially fine root ( < 3mm ) biomass on northern exposition sites was bigger than that on southern exposition sites. analysis of the vertical root distribution parameters, root extinction coefficient, indicated that the value of on northern exposition was more than 0. 982, while the value of on southern exposition was less than 0. 982, which indicated that the vertical root distribution depth of robinia pseudoacacia on southern exposition was deeper than that on southern exposition. and the distribution depth of fine roots ( < 1mm ) was deeper than that of thicker roots ( < 3mm ), which was in favor of the uptake of water and nutrients from deeper layers, helped the trees to adapt the arid environment, and promoted the growth of the upper parts of the tree

The research team of prof chan hsiao chang, director of the epithelial cell biology research centre, in collaboration with zhejiang academy of medical sciences, demonstrated that cystic fibrosis transmembrane conductance regulator cftr is involved in transporting bicarbonate into sperm, and thus, is vital to sperm fertilizing capacity and male fertility. cftr is an anion channel, mutations of which cause cystic fibrosis, a disease characterized by defective cl - and hco3 - transport with clinical manifestations in a number of organ systems
